In this way, what do Gold Rush apples taste like?

The GoldRush apple has a medium to coarse grained, firm, crisp, and pale yellow flesh that is slow to brown once sliced. The flavor of the GoldRush is complex, spicy, and maintains bright acidity at harvest.

Also, what is a Nittany Apple? Introduced by the Pennsylvania State University, Nittany is a York Imperial-type apple possessing outstanding processing characteristics. Its flavor and attractive orange-red color also give it good fresh market potential. Flesh oxidizes very slowly and imparts a highly desirable yellow color to processed products.

What kind of apples are Pink Lady?

Pink Lady® apples were developed by a man named John Cripps of Western Australia's Department of Agriculture. They are the result of a cross between Lady Williams and Golden Delicious apples. What makes Granny Smith apples sour?

Granny Smith apples are high in acid and lean in sugar, for example, and Fujis are decidedly sweet with a subtle acidity. Regardless of the varietal differences, the sweet-sour balance of any apple evolves during storage. Apples are climacteric, which means they contain starch that converts to sugar after harvest.

What are Ginger Gold apples?

Ginger Gold apples have a pale yellow skin with slight russeting on the surface. They are variable in size, but tend toward conical in shape, sometimes with ribs and long stalks. They have a crisp, cream-colored flesh with a sweet, mildly tart taste.

What do Mutsu apples taste like?

Mustu apples are smooth bright green to yellow in color. Its firm white flesh is crisp and juicy with a sweet-tart flavor that has subtle hints of spice. An excellent keeper, the Mutsu apple will take on an even sweeter flavor in cold storage.

What zone do Honeycrisp apples grow in?

Most varieties flourish in the U.S. Department of Agriculture hardiness zones 4 to 7, and specialized varieties can grow in climates as cold as zone 3 or as warm as zone 10. Some are easier to grow than others, and unfortunately the hugely popular Honeycrisp variety is one of the more challenging cultivars.

What is a crimson crisp apple?

Apple, Crimson Crisp Medium-sized, extremely crisp creamy-white flesh, with tart, very good, rich flavor. Midseason harvest, with fruits storing for 6 months. Spreading, well-branched trees are immune to scab and moderately resistant to leaf rust.

What does a cameo apple taste like?

Its flesh is dense and creamy white to yellow in color with a crisp and juicy texture. The Cameo's flavor is the perfect balance of sweet and tart with nuances of both honey and citrus.
